I'm also hoping we'll see another Ghibli film along with Ponyo on Blu-ray. If it does happen it will probably be either Spirited Away or Howl's Moving Castle since those are from digital sources and will look the best.

The older films all have HD transfers, however many of them were done years ago on (by now at least) antiquated equipment, and if the recent Joe Hisaishi Concert is any indication will not look great on Blu-ray unless they decide to re-do them.
